Ankita Raina and Vaishnavi Adkar led India to a thrilling 2-1 win over South Korea in the Billie Jean King Cup, securing the team's spot in the Asia/Oceania group.

Ankita, India's most experienced campaigner, fought hard against Dayeon Back, but ultimately lost 1-6, 5-7. However, Vaishnavi Adkar made up for it with an impressive performance, winning 7-6 (2), 7-6 (5) against Park So-hyun.

Ankita then paired with Rutuja Bhosale to win the doubles 6-2, 6-2, securing India's third spot in the round robin tournament.

India finished with three wins and two losses this week, retaining their spot in the Asia-Oceania group.
